This 1971 Hinckley Bermuda 40 is a full-displacement cruising yawl built with solid fiberglass construction throughout the deck and hull. The design combines a full keel with a centerboard, a proven configuration for seaworthiness and versatility. At just over 40 feet in length with an 11.75-foot beam, the yacht balances the stability needed for extended cruising with manageable proportions.
Power comes from a Universal M-40 diesel engine rated at 32 horsepower, recently rebuilt. The rigging has been upgraded, supporting the yacht's role as a serious cruising platform. The fiberglass hull and deck have proven their durability over more than five decades, providing a solid foundation for ongoing use and enjoyment.
